#1cb4b5 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1cb4b5 is composed of 11% red, 70.6% green and 71%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 84.5% cyan, 0.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 29% black. It has a hue angle of 180.4 degrees, a saturation of 73.2% and a lightness of 41%. #1cb4b5 color hex could be obtained by blending #38ffff with #00696b. Closest websafe color is: #33cccc.

Shades and Tints of #1cb4b5
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020b0b is the darkest color, while #f9fefe is the lightest one.
